Washington State University is a popular decision for individuals pursuing a bachelor's degree in computational science. Located in the town of Pullman, Wazzu is a public university with a fairly large student population. You also may be intersted to know that the school ranks #1 in quality for bachelor's degrees in computational science in Washington.
